PLC Outputs to CGM Inputs for PLC Control Description
Change Flow Rate or Pressure Set Point: Changes the flow or pressure set point if in
operator mode, or the flow or pressure set point for the selected shot number if in shot
mode. The set point change is either pressure or flow depending if the HFR is configured to
constant pressure or flow mode.
The PLC value to the CGM is an integer and must be multiplied by 1000 for the requested
flow rate to be in system units.
Example: Flow Rate desired is 17.125 cc/sec. Send double word 14 = 17125 (unit chosen is
cc/sec)
Change Dispense Amount Set Point: Changes the current shot selected to a new dispense
amount (shot size). The value sent to the CGM must be an integer. Units depend on what is
chosen in the system setup.
The PLC value to the CGM is an integer and must be multiplied by 1000 for the requested
flow rate to be in system units.
Example: Dispense Amount desired is 150 grams. Send double word 18 = 150000 (unit
chosen is grams)

Change the Temperature Set Point: Changes zone selected to a temperature in °C. The
value sent to the CGM must be an integer. Units are °C regardless of the units chosen in
the system setup. Note the temperature set points are limited by the temperature high and
low alarm values. The alarm set points must be greater than 10 degrees from the requested
set point. If the alarm is closer than 10 degrees the requested set point will be ignored. Note
these bytes are combined with bytes 24,25 (zone to change).
The PLC value is xx.x and must be multiplied by 10 prior to being sent to the CGM. The
value must be in °C.
Example: Change Red Hose Temperature to 102°F. Send 238 (23.8°C) to the CGM along
with the zone (see bytes 24,25)
Change the Temperature zone: Changes zone in which the temperature set point will be
changed. Note these bytes are combined with bytes 22,23 (temperature to change).
When changing a heat zone, select the appropriate zone number which will enable the
CGM to write a new temperature set point to the heat zone selected. Only 1 heat zone can
be selected at a time. Bytes 24,25 (MSW) + 22,23 (LSW) are combined to form a double
word from the PLC output to CGM input.
0 = Red Tank Heater
1 = Blue Tank Heater
2 = Red Inline Heater
3 = Blue Inline Heater
4 = Red Hose Heater
5 = Blue Hose Heater
6 = Red Chiller
7 = Blue Chiller
Example: Change Red Hose Temperature to 102°F. Send integer "4" to word 24 and
combine with integer "238" in word 22 (23.8°C) to the CGM (see bytes 22,23).
